  • Triggernomics History (FAQs)

    Triggernomics History (FAQs)

    (Article from Triggernomic's old website (2002ish) I am a Designer of Jewelry and Utensils. I received my Diploma after studying in Pforzheim, Germany for 3 years at the School for Goldsmiths and Watchmakers. I have worked for quite a few jewelers on the East coast of the U.S.A., learning many new techniques and putting to use the ones I had learned. My wife and I now live in Maine for the past 5 years and have great jobs working for excellent crafts people as well as doing freelance work at home. ...

  • Dual Mag History and Pics

    Dual Mag History and Pics

    AO,

    You all got a kick out of the pics of the Dual Mag from World Cup. I went through our old picture albums and pulled out some pics for you all to see.

    Enjoy!!

    I made the Dual Mag custom for Mike Lauterborn who had helped us out a lot at the time. This was in the early 90's but I don't remember exactly when. He promoted the gun all over the west coast. I still think this was one of the best APG covers ever, remember this is when everyone st...
